The hatchback 5 doors Nissan March 2010 - 2016 year modification 1.2 CVT (79 hp)

Engine

Engine type petrol
Engine location front, transverse
Engine capacity, cm³ 1198
Boost type No
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m 79 / 58 at 4400
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m 106 at —
Cylinder arrangement in-line
Number of cylinders 4
Number of valves per cylinder 4
Engine power supply system distributed injection

General information

Brand country Japan
Car class B
Number of doors 5

Performance indicators

Fuel type Super (95)
Maximum speed, km/h 170

Sizes in mm

Length 3780
Width 1665
Height 1515
Wheelbase 2450
Ground clearance 140
Front track width 1470
Rear track width 1475

Suspension and brakes

Type of front suspension independent, spring
Type of rear suspension semi-independent, torsion
Front brakes disk ventilated
Rear brakes disc

Transmission

Transmission variator
Drive type front

Volume and weight

Fuel tank capacity, l 41
Curb weight, kg 1215

Nissan March: A Compact Hatchback with Japanese Precision

The Nissan March, a compact hatchback produced between 2010 and 2016, is a quintessential example of Japanese engineering. Designed for urban environments, this car combines practicality, efficiency, and reliability in a compact package. With its 1.2-liter petrol engine and continuously variable transmission (CVT), the Nissan March is tailored for drivers seeking a balance between performance and fuel economy. Its five-door hatchback design ensures versatility, making it an ideal choice for small families or city commuters.

Performance and Efficiency

Under the hood, the Nissan March features a 1.2-liter petrol engine that delivers 79 horsepower and 106 Nm of torque. While these figures may not seem impressive at first glance, they are more than adequate for city driving. The CVT ensures smooth acceleration and optimal fuel efficiency, making it a practical choice for daily commutes. With a top speed of 170 km/h, the March is capable of handling highway speeds comfortably. Its front-wheel-drive configuration and lightweight design contribute to its nimble handling, making it easy to maneuver through tight city streets.

Design and Dimensions

The Nissan March's compact dimensions—3780 mm in length, 1665 mm in width, and 1515 mm in height—make it perfect for urban environments. Its 2450 mm wheelbase provides a stable ride, while the 140 mm ground clearance ensures it can handle minor bumps and uneven roads. The car's five-door hatchback design offers practicality, with ample space for passengers and cargo. The interior is designed with simplicity and functionality in mind, ensuring a comfortable driving experience.

Safety and Suspension

Safety is a priority in the Nissan March, with features like ventilated front disc brakes and rear disc brakes providing reliable stopping power. The front suspension is independent and spring-based, offering a smooth ride, while the rear semi-independent torsion suspension ensures stability. These features, combined with the car's lightweight construction, contribute to its overall safety and handling capabilities.

Pros and Cons

  • Pros: The Nissan March is fuel-efficient, easy to maneuver, and practical for city driving. Its compact size makes parking a breeze, and the CVT ensures smooth acceleration. The five-door design adds versatility, making it suitable for small families.
  • Cons: The 79 horsepower engine may feel underpowered for those seeking a more spirited driving experience. Additionally, the interior design, while functional, may lack the premium feel of some competitors.

Conclusion

The Nissan March is a reliable and efficient compact hatchback that excels in urban environments. Its practical design, combined with Japanese engineering, makes it a solid choice for city commuters and small families. While it may not offer the power or luxury of larger vehicles, its affordability, fuel efficiency, and ease of use make it a compelling option in its class. Whether you're navigating crowded streets or looking for a dependable daily driver, the Nissan March delivers on its promises.
